Tracing limits for the Opaline mesh. Spans are sampled per-service; budgets are enforced at the Kestrelgate collector. Reviewers: reject changes that raise cardinality without a quota bump. Trace retention is seven days, head-based sampling only. Exceeding the span cap drops silently, so check dashboards after merge. Current enforced constants are defined here.

tuning constants:
RATE_LIMITS = {
    "zorix": 1,
    "quenael": 1,
    "ulawyn": 1,
    "wenwyn": 2,
}

Subject: Tide-table widget cut-over — done

Hi,

Cut-over of the TideGlass widget from the legacy Moonwake feed to the new harmonic service finished this morning. Traffic moved in two steps with no errors logged; cached predictions were invalidated cleanly. For review purposes: rendering code is unchanged, only the data-source layer and polling cadence differ. Rollback path stays open for a week. The configuration now active in production is listed below.

service settings:
PRAIX_LOG_LEVEL=error
PRAIX_METRICS_HOST=metrics.praix.qorvelcorp.corp
PRAIX_POOL_SIZE=16

TICKET #—, missed pick-up
Hey records team — Quillon Carriers never showed for the crate of survey instruments from the Fenwood depot yesterday. Crate's still sealed and sitting in the cage. Rebooked with Marrow Line for Thursday morning. Nothing needs re-logging, just update the ledger. Give their driver the instruction below at hand-over.

courier memo of yawep-yafog: the pramir ulaix courier leaves the ulavan aldix frair zorok oliiel joreth rusdor fenvan ledger at gate 1305 under passcode 514738

## SketchForge Recovery: Undo/Redo State

When reviewing recovery patches for SketchForge's diagram editor, verify that the undo and redo stacks are serialized before the account snapshot is taken; otherwise restored sessions lose history ordering. After the snapshot validates, the recovery tool unlocks the history archive only when you supply the passphrase shown below.

unlock words, fafop-hawep: briwyn-oliix-sorox